&lt;p&gt;The &amp;quot;/RelationshipType&amp;quot; part of the URI means &amp;quot;give me all relationships of the Item specified before that are called &amp;#39;RelationshipType&amp;#39;&amp;quot;. Your custom ItemType &amp;quot;Airbus_cabin_configuration&amp;quot; does not have any Relationships with the name &amp;quot;RelationshipType&amp;quot;. Its relationships are called &amp;quot;Cabin_seat, Cabin_Lavatory&amp;quot;, etc.&lt;br /&gt;I assumed you wanted to know the names of RelationshipTypes on a given ItemType, not the actual relationship instances on instances of a particular custom ItemType. If you send the request ending in&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;&lt;br /&gt;&amp;nbsp;&amp;nbsp;&amp;nbsp;&amp;nbsp;&amp;nbsp; ItemType(&amp;#39;ID of the ItemType Airbus_cabin_configuration&amp;#39;)/RelationshipType&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;this is exactly what you will get. A collection of &amp;quot;value&amp;quot;-nodes that include the names of your RelationshipTypes (Cabin_seat, Cabin_Lavatory, etc). &l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;If you need the actual instances of these RelationshipTypes on a given Airbus_Cabin_configuration, you will have to combine the result of the above query to get the names of the relationships and then a request like&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;&lt;span style="background-color:#ffffff;color:#505050;float:none;font-family:OpenSans, Helvetica, Arial, sans-serif;font-size:12px;font-style:normal;font-weight:400;letter-spacing:normal;text-align:left;text-indent:0px;text-transform:none;white-space:pre-wrap;"&gt; Airbus_cabin_configuration(&amp;#39;AB0358B1D3774D77AC507CA1F857F42E&amp;#39;)/Cabin_seat&lt;br /&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;br /&gt;to fetch the relationship instances.&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;Is this what you mean?&lt;/p&gt;

&lt;p&gt;your request should look something like this&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;GET &amp;nbsp;&amp;nbsp; &amp;lt;URI for your Aras Installation&amp;gt;/server/odata/ItemType(&amp;#39;&amp;lt;ID for the ItemType you want to query&amp;gt;&amp;#39;)/RelationshipType&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;You will need to replace &amp;lt;URI for your Aras Installation&amp;gt; in the URI with the path for your Aras installation (like http://localhost/InnovatorServer) and the given &lt;span style="background-color:#ffffff;color:#505050;float:none;font-family:OpenSans, Helvetica, Arial, sans-serif;font-size:12px;font-style:normal;font-weight:normal;letter-spacing:normal;text-align:left;text-indent:0px;text-transform:none;white-space:pre-wrap;"&gt;&amp;lt;ID for the ItemType you want to query&amp;gt;&lt;/span&gt; with the ID of the ItemType you want to know the RelationshipTypes for.&lt;/p&gt;
